Abstract
The utility model discloses Expressway Service panorama high point monitor cameras, including ring flange, fixed bolt, solar energy electroplax, interior machine and screw-threaded counterbore, the inside of the ring flange is equipped with equidistant screw-threaded counterbore, the inside of screw-threaded counterbore is all hinged with fixed bolt, the top of the ring flange is fixed with fixed block, single-chip microcontroller is installed on the lateral wall of fixed block, the inside of the fixed block is equipped with groove body, the inside of groove body is equipped with battery, the top of the fixed block is equipped with bracket, the top of the bracket is fixed with shell, the both ends of shell are all equipped with inner disc, center position inside the inner disc is equipped with interior machine, inner disc surface above interior machine is fixed with one-way expansion bar, the top of the shell is equipped with baffle.The utility model not only increases convenience when monitoring camera uses, and avoids the wasting of resources of monitoring camera, and improves the degree of automation when monitoring camera uses.

Working principle: in use, ring flange 1 is placed in suitable position first, inside rotation screw-threaded counterbore 16
Fixed bolt 3 ring flange 1 is fixed, to realize that monitoring camera is easily installed the function in disassembly, to enhance prison
Convenience when control camera shooting uses, later by the bracket 5 of 4 top of rotation fixed block to suitable position, to realize prison
The function that camera angle is adjusted is controlled, light energy collection is carried out in used photovoltaic control by the solar energy electroplax 10 on 12 top of baffle later
Device processed converts light energy into electric energy and stores to the battery 17 inside groove body 18, to realize monitoring camera luminous energy conversion electric energy
Effect controls the one-way expansion bar 11 on 8 surface of inner disc finally by single-chip microcontroller 2 so as to avoid the wasting of resources of monitoring camera
Cause to clear up head 9 and slide up and down that the spot on interior 13 surface of machine is caused to be cleaned, to realize the function of monitoring camera automated cleaning
Can, to improve the degree of automation when monitoring camera uses, complete Expressway Service panorama high point monitor camera
Work.
